Transaction e111af211333d7567594c95f2b4744b40b5e2bb6069c66ddb9b889469cae398f
1 Input
1 Output
-
e111af211333d7567594c95f2b4744b40b5e2bb6069c66ddb9b889469cae398f:0
- value
- 108306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 895144ce400ba4f01a53fc1fa1baa2dd74e0b740 OP_EQUAL
- address
- 3ED5rUfaQpTxpE62XBmJSYWUYdEVnkty72